variety, breed, cultivar, strain
A distinct variety or breed of a plant or animal, especially one developed through selective breeding or cultivation. Widely used in agriculture, horticulture, and animal husbandry.
新しい品種のイチゴが開発された。
A new variety of strawberry was developed.
この地域では米の品種が豊富だ。
This region has a rich variety of rice cultivars.
病気に強い品種を選んで栽培することが大切だ。
It's important to choose and cultivate varieties that are resistant to disease.
Used for both plants and animals. In Japan, discussions of rice 品種 (like コシヒカリ, あきたこまち, etc.) are very common. Also used for dog breeds, flower varieties, and other cultivated species.
COMMON COLLOCATIONS:
- 品種改良 — breed/variety improvement
- 新品種 — new variety/breed
- 品種を開発する — to develop a new variety
- 在来品種 — indigenous/traditional variety
